Abstract
La presente invención se refiere a un tambor rotatorio plegador de cinturón, que comprende: una flecha principal cilíndrica, rotatoria, un par de ensambles de maza central, montados deslizablemente en la flecha principal, en lados opuestos de un plano central del tambor, una pluralidad de segmentos de tambor circunferencialmente separados, dispuestos en una configuración generalmente cilíndrica alrededor de los ensambles de maza central, incluyendo cada uno de los segmentos de tambor miembros deslizadores montados deslizablemente sobre el par de ensambles de maza central, para movimiento radial de cada uno de los segmentos de tambor con respecto a los ensambles de maza central; un par de cámaras de aire expansoras una cavidad en comunicación con una fuente de presión de fluido, incluyendo cada una de las cámaras de aire expansoras una cavidad en comunicación con una fuente de presión de fluido, incluyendo cada uno de los segmentos de tambor un medio de soporte de cámara de aire montado en forma deslizable sobre cada uno de los segmentos de tambor y conectado en forma ajustable a los miembros deslizadores, para ajuste axial del medio de soporte de cámara de aire en cada extremo de los segmentos de tambor, estando el par de cámaras de aire expansoras, montados sobre el medio de soporte de cámara de aire, para movimiento de ajuste axial con el medio de soporte de cámara de aire, medios de tornillo separador en acoplamiento roscado con los ensambles de maza central, siendo rotatorios los medios de tornillo para mover los ensambles de masa central, en direcciones opuestas para alargar y cortar la distancia entre las cámaras de aire, un par de ensambles de masa expansora de tambor, montados deslizablemente sobre la flecha principal, en posiciones axialmente separadas de los ensambles de masa central, y en lados opuestos de los ensambles de masa central, desde el plano central; medios de eslabon que conectan cada uno de los ensambles de masa expansora de tambor con un extremo opuesto de cada uno de los segmentos; medios de tornillo de diámetro de tambor, en acoplamiento roscado con los ensambles de masa expansora de tambor, y siendo los medios de tornillo de diámetro de tambor rotatorios para expandir y contraer los segmentos.
